LV3096 Small Barcode Scan Engine 5Mil Reading Precision For Hand - Held PDA Pad
The LV3096 scan engine, armed with the patented UIMG , a computerized image recognition system, brings about a new era of 2D barcode scan engines.
The LV3096’s 2D barcode decoder chip ingeniously blends UIMG technology and advanced chip design & manufacturing, which significantly simplifies application design and delivers superior performance and solid reliability with low power consumption.
The LV3096 supports all mainstream 1D as well as PDF417, QR Code (M1/M2/Micro), Data Matrix and GS1-DataBarTM(RSS) (Limited/ Stacked/ Expanded versions).
This compact engine weighs only 5 grams and fits easily into even the most space-constrained equipments such as data collectors, meter readers, ticket validators and PDAs.
2D Barcode Decoder Chip: The engine armed with the state-of-the-art 2D barcode decoder chip invented by Newland demonstrates unprecedented reading performance.
Two-In-One Design: Seamless integration of CMOS image sensor and decoder board makes the engine small, lightweight and easy for integration.
High Performance & Ultra-Low Power Consumption: The engine can read 1D and 2D barcodes with a power consumption only one third that of a traditional engine.
All-Round Scanning Capability: It can read barcodes on virtually any medium - paper, plastic cards, mobile phones and LCD displays.
| Performance | ||
| Image Sensor | 752×480 CMOS | |
| Processor | IOTC 2D decoder chip 48MHz | |
| Illumination | Red LED 625±10 nm | |
| Symbologies | 2D | PDF 417, Data Matrix(ECC200,ECC000,050,080,100,140), QR Code |
| 1D | Code 128, EAN-13, EAN-8, Code 39, UPC-A, UPC-E, Codabar, Interleaved 2 of 5, ITF-6, ITF-14, ISBN, Code 93, UCC/EAN-128, GS1 Databar, Matrix 2 of 5, Code 11, Industrial 2 of 5, Standard 2 of 5, Plessey, MSI-Plessey, etc. | |
| Reading Precision | ≥ 5mil | |
| Depth of Field* | EAN13 (13mil) | 55mm - 185mm |
| Code 39 (5mil) | 55mm - 100mm | |
| PDF 417 (6.67mil) | 40mm - 130mm | |
| Data Matrix (10mil) | 40mm - 135mm | |
| QR Code (15mil) | 40mm - 160mm | |
| Symbol Contrast | ≥ 30% reflectance difference | |
| Scan Angle** | Roll: 360°, Pitch: ±55°, Skew: ±55° | |
| Field of View | Horizontal 36°; Vertical 23° | |
| Mechanical/Electrical | ||
| Interface | TTL-232, USB (optional) | |
| Rated Power Consumption | 0.76 W | |
| Operating Voltage | 3.3±10% VDC | |
| Current @ 3.3 VDC | 230 mA | |
| 4mA (USB communication not supported); 7mA (USB communication supported) | ||
| <5 uA | ||
| Dimensions | 21.17(W)×14.6(D)×11.52(H)mm | |
| Weight | 5.0g | |
| Environmental | ||
| Operating Temperature | -20℃~ +60℃ | |
| Storage Temperature | -40℃~ +80℃ | |
| Humidity | 5% ~ 95% (non-condensing) | |
| Ambient Light | 0 ~ 100000 lux (natural light) | |
| Certifications | ||
| FCC Part15 Class B, CE EMC Class B | ||
| Accessories | ||
| EVK3000 | Software development board, equipped with a trigger button, beeper and RS-232 & USB interfaces. | |
| Cable | Used to connect the EVK3000 to a host device; equipped with a power connector. | |
| Used to connect the EVK3000 to a host device. | ||
| Power Adaptor | Used to provide power for the EVK3000. | |
| Output: DC5V, 2A; Input: AC100~240V, 50~60Hz | ||
| * Test conditions: T=23℃, Illumination=300 LUX | ||
| ** Test conditions: | ||
| Code 39, 3 Bytes; Resolution=10mil; W:N=3:1; PCS=0.8; Barcode Height=11mm; Scan Distance=120mm, T=23℃, Illumination=300 LUX | ||
